当前位置:首页 > 程序系统 > 正文内容

html文件与css文件如何连接,HTML与CSS文件连接指南

wzgly1个月前 (07-19)程序系统2
要将HTML文件与CSS文件连接,需要在HTML文件的`标签内使用标签引入CSS文件,具体步骤如下:,1. 在HTML文件的部分添加一个标签。,2. 设置标签的rel属性为stylesheet,表示这是一个样式表。,3. 设置标签的href属性,指向CSS文件的路径,如果CSS文件与HTML文件在同一目录下,只需提供文件名;如果不在同一目录,需要给出相对路径或绝对路径。,,`html,,,, ,,, ,,,`,在这段代码中,styles.css`是CSS文件的名称,它会被链接到HTML文件中,用于定义页面的样式。

嗨,大家好!我最近在学习HTML和CSS,想问一下,HTML文件和CSS文件是如何连接起来的呢?我听说需要用到链接标签,但是具体怎么做呢?希望有人能详细解释一下。

一:链接标签的使用

  1. 引入CSS文件:在HTML文件的部分,使用标签来引入CSS文件。

    html文件与css文件如何连接
    <link rel="stylesheet" type="text/css" href="styles.css">

    这里,href属性指定了CSS文件的路径。

  2. rel属性rel属性用来指定链接的关系,对于样式表,我们通常使用stylesheet

  3. type属性type属性用来指定链接资源的MIME类型,对于CSS文件,我们使用text/css

  4. 媒体查询:如果你想要针对不同的媒体类型(如打印、屏幕等)应用不同的CSS样式,可以使用media属性。

    <link rel="stylesheet" type="text/css" href="print.css" media="print">
  5. 样式表优先级:如果页面中存在多个样式表,浏览器会按照在HTML中引入的顺序来应用样式。

    html文件与css文件如何连接

二:内部样式

  1. 在HTML文件中添加样式:在HTML文件中,你可以在部分或部分的开始处直接添加样式。

    <style>
      body { background-color: #f0f0f0; }
    </style>
  2. 选择器:内部样式使用CSS选择器来指定样式规则。

  3. 样式覆盖:内部样式会覆盖外部样式表中相同的样式规则。

  4. 代码组织:虽然内部样式简单易用,但对于大型项目,使用外部样式表可以更好地组织代码和维护。

  5. 浏览器缓存:外部样式表一旦被下载,就会被浏览器缓存,这样可以提高页面加载速度。

    html文件与css文件如何连接

三:外部样式表

  1. 创建CSS文件:创建一个单独的CSS文件,例如styles.css

  2. 编写CSS规则:在CSS文件中编写样式规则,

    body {
      background-color: #f0f0f0;
      font-family: Arial, sans-serif;
    }
  3. 链接到HTML文件:在HTML文件中使用<link>标签将CSS文件链接到HTML文件。

  4. 样式继承:CSS样式可以继承,子元素会继承父元素的样式。

  5. 模块化:通过将CSS规则分散到不同的文件中,可以实现样式模块化,便于管理和复用。

四:样式表优先级和选择器权重

  1. 优先级:CSS选择器的优先级决定了当存在冲突时,哪个样式会被应用,优先级高的样式会覆盖优先级低的样式。

  2. 权重计算:选择器的权重是通过选择器的复杂度来计算的,复杂的选择器具有更高的权重。

  3. 特定性:选择器的特定性也影响样式的应用,特定性高的选择器具有更高的权重。

  4. 继承和层叠:CSS样式通过继承和层叠来应用,层叠规则决定了样式应用的顺序。

  5. 调试工具:使用浏览器的开发者工具可以帮助你调试CSS样式,查看选择器的权重和特定性。 相信大家对HTML文件与CSS文件的连接有了更深入的了解,在实际开发中,合理地使用HTML和CSS可以让我们创建出更加美观和高效的网页。

其他相关扩展阅读资料参考文献:

HTML文件与CSS文件的连接方式

HTML文件与CSS文件的介绍

HTML(HyperText Markup Language)是用于创建网页的标准标记语言,而CSS(Cascading Style Sheets)是用于描述网页样式和布局的语言,为了让网页具有更好的视觉效果和布局,通常需要将HTML文件与CSS文件连接起来。

一:内联样式

直接在HTML元素中使用style属性添加CSS样式。 这种方式适用于简单的样式应用,直接在元素中添加style="属性:值"即可,但这种方式不够灵活,不推荐大型项目使用。 示例<p style="color:red;">这是一段红色文字。</p>

二:内部样式表

在HTML文件的<head>部分使用<style>标签定义CSS样式。 这种方式适用于单个页面的样式定义,但对于大型网站,这种方式不够灵活且不易维护。 示例:在<head>部分添加<style>body {background-color: blue;}</style>

三:外部链接方式

使用HTML文件的<link>标签链接外部的CSS文件。 这是最常用的方式,通过<link rel="stylesheet" href="styles.css">将外部的CSS文件链接到HTML文件中,这种方式使得样式和结构的分离,提高了代码的可维护性。 示例:在HTML文件的<head>部分添加<link rel="stylesheet" href="styles.css">。“styles.css”是CSS文件的路径。 优点:便于管理和维护,可以在多个页面之间复用样式。 注意事项:确保CSS文件的路径正确,否则无法正确加载样式。

四:导入样式表

使用CSS的@import规则导入其他CSS文件。 可以在一个CSS文件中使用@import语句导入其他CSS文件,实现样式的模块化,但这种方式不如直接链接方式高效,因为它会阻塞浏览器的渲染过程。 示例:在CSS文件中使用@import url('styles.css');导入其他样式表,但这种方式在现代前端开发中使用较少。 注意事项:由于性能问题,一般不推荐使用大量@import语句,可以考虑使用前端构建工具进行优化。

总结与最佳实践建议 在实际开发中,推荐使用外部链接方式连接HTML文件和CSS文件,因为它具有良好的模块化特性,便于管理和维护,避免在HTML元素中直接使用style属性定义样式,除非是非常简单的样式需求,对于大型项目,建议使用前端构建工具进行样式的模块化管理和优化。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/cxxt/15104.html

分享给朋友:

“html文件与css文件如何连接,HTML与CSS文件连接指南” 的相关文章

java虚拟机运行什么文件,Java虚拟机运行.class文件

java虚拟机运行什么文件,Java虚拟机运行.class文件

Java虚拟机(JVM)运行的是以.class为扩展名的Java字节码文件,这些文件是Java源代码编译后的结果,包含了指令集和运行时数据,JVM负责将这些字节码文件加载到内存中,执行其中的指令,实现Java程序的多平台运行。Java虚拟机运行什么文件? 用户解答: 嗨,我最近在学习Java,有...

网页动画,网页动态魅力,探索网页动画的艺术与技巧

网页动画,网页动态魅力,探索网页动画的艺术与技巧

网页动画是一种通过动态图像和视频在网页上实现的视觉效果,它能够丰富网页内容,提升用户体验,增强信息传达的吸引力,动画形式多样,包括逐帧动画、关键帧动画和交互动画等,网页动画设计需考虑页面加载速度、兼容性以及用户体验,以实现高效、美观的交互效果。用户提问:嗨,我想了解一下网页动画的制作,但是我对这方面...

java编程思想第六版pdf百度云,Java编程思想第六版官方PDF版下载

java编程思想第六版pdf百度云,Java编程思想第六版官方PDF版下载

《Java编程思想》第六版,是一部全面介绍Java编程语言的经典之作,书中地讲解了Java编程的核心概念和最佳实践,涵盖面向对象编程、集合框架、泛型、异常处理、I/O操作等多个方面,通过大量实例和练习,帮助读者掌握Java编程技巧,提高编程能力,本书适合Java初学者和有一定基础的读者阅读,是学习J...

mid函数参数含义,Mid函数参数详解

mid函数参数含义,Mid函数参数详解

mid函数是一种字符串处理函数,用于从指定字符串中提取一段子字符串,其参数含义如下:第一个参数为源字符串,第二个参数为开始位置,第三个参数为结束位置,开始位置和结束位置都是基于0的索引,表示从源字符串的哪个位置开始提取,以及提取到哪个位置结束,如果不指定结束位置,则默认提取到字符串的末尾。 嗨,你...

多线程编程语言,深入解析多线程编程语言,高效并发之道

多线程编程语言,深入解析多线程编程语言,高效并发之道

多线程编程语言是一种支持并发执行多个线程的编程语言,它允许开发者创建多个执行单元,这些单元可以同时运行,提高程序执行效率,多线程编程语言通常提供线程创建、同步、通信等机制,如Java、C++、Python等,通过合理利用多线程,可以优化资源利用,提高程序性能。地了解多线程编程语言 真实用户解答:...

jquery获取iframe子页面元素,jQuery轻松访问iframe内部页面元素教程

jquery获取iframe子页面元素,jQuery轻松访问iframe内部页面元素教程

在jQuery中获取iframe子页面的元素,可以通过以下步骤实现:首先确保父页面和iframe子页面都加载了jQuery库,使用$(iframe).contents().find(selector)方法来选择iframe内部的元素,这里的iframe是jQuery对象,而selector是用于选择...